11 votos

Hay scripts de Greasemonkey para Safari?

No es el maravilloso Greasemonkey para ejecutar definido por el usuario JavaScript en las páginas web.

Existe tal cosa como Greasemonkey para Safari? O uno en lugar de escribir un Safari de Extensión para personalizar el comportamiento de otras páginas web? Tal vez hay una alternativa que se ejecuta en AppleScript en lugar de JavaScript?

6voto

Dave Penneys Puntos 3064

Otra opción para ejecutar scripts de GreaseMonkey es NinjaKit (que es lo que yo uso). Es un Safari 5 extensión, lo que significa que es sólo un poco más seguro que GreaseKit.

3voto

fpg1503 Puntos 101

Yo uso TamperMonkey y funciona sorprendentemente bien. Es también una Extensión de Safari.

He intentado utilizar NinjaKit en el pasado pero ya no trabaja para mí, una gran cantidad de secuencias de comandos simplemente no funcionará.

2voto

shsteimer Puntos 8749

Existe tal cosa como Greasemonkey para Safari?

Usted puede utilizar SIMBL y GreaseKit para ejecutar la mayoría de los scripts de Greasemonkey en Safari, sin modificar. Instrucciones de instalación detalladas se encuentran en este enlace, que se repite aquí:

  1. Descargar e instalar SIMBL
  2. Salir De Safari
  3. Descargar GreaseKit
  4. Arrastre el GreaseKit.archivo de paquete de a ~/Library/Application Support/SIMBL/Plugins. Usted puede necesitar para crear esta ubicación si no de salida
  5. Inicio de Safari y verás un GreaseKit elemento de la barra de menú
  6. Secuencias de comandos de instalación de http://userscripts.org -- el proceso de instalación es un poco diferente de la de Firefox enfoque, pero funciona.

O uno en lugar de escribir un Safari de Extensión para personalizar el comportamiento de otras páginas web? Tal vez hay una alternativa que se ejecuta en AppleScript en lugar de JavaScript?

El nativo-a-Safari equivalente de Greasemonkey es AppleScript extensiones y plugins. Para una buena biblioteca de los nativos de extensiones de Safari retirar Pimp My Safari.

1voto

Josh Bush Puntos 1938

El mejor lugar para comenzar es, probablemente, va a ser aquí: http://developer.apple.com/devcenter/safari/index.action

He visto las extensiones de safari cuyo comportamiento sólo era para personalizar el comportamiento de los sitios web; ayer vi a uno que cambió el diseño de reddit para ser más iOS-friendly.

aquí está.

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by: